Is Typhoon Glenda a super typhoon?

Is Typhoon Glenda a super typhoon?

Typhoon Rammasun, known in the Philippines as Typhoon Glenda, was one of the only three Category 5 super typhoons on record in the South China Sea, with the other ones being Pamela in 1954 and Meranti in 2016. Rammasun had destructive impacts across the Philippines, South China, and Vietnam in July 2014.

Where did Glenda hit Philippines?

Albay province Glenda was the seventh typhoon to enter the Philippine Area of Responsibility this year, and it made its first landfall in Albay province at around 5:00pm with maximum sustained winds of 150 kilometres per hour. The whole Sorsogon province sprang into action a few days before and after Typhoon Glenda made landfall.

What is the effects of Typhoon Glenda?

The powerful winds of Glenda (international name: Rammasun, which in Thai means “God of Thunder”) brought down trees, electric posts and ripped off roofs across Metro Manila, where government offices, schools and the stock market were shuttered for the day.

Why Philippines is called the Ring of Fire?

The Philippines belong to the Pacific Ring of Fire where the oceanic Philippine plate and several smaller micro-plates are subducting along the Philippine Trench to the E, and the Luzon, Sulu and several other small Trenches to the W. Tectonic setting of the Philippines.

Where did Typhoon Rammasun hit in the Philippines?

Last July 16, 2014, Typhoon Rammasun (Glenda), the strongest typhoon to hit the Philippines this year, made its landfall Tuesday night (July 15, 2014) in Rapu-Rapu, Albay. It affected Regions I, III, IV-A, IV-B, V, VIII and NCR with sustained winds of 140 kilometers per hour.

How many people are affected by Glenda in the Philippines?

Out of the affected, 525,791 persons or 99,548 families were displaced and evacuated to 1,200 evacuation centers. A total of 26,259 houses were damaged by Glenda. The NDRRMC also reported a total of Php 892 million worth of damages to infrastructure and Php 4.5 billion worth of damages to agriculture.
